Output c5713649192e936d408b9db22d639461519e0f4858b1937f679e139632199f5a:3

value
551656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e50699510d19e6e1e0db3a64c8063b26d09f114 OP_EQUAL
address
3G8721LTrBEpXAunKYRMYjJaRDiF78wKor
transaction
c5713649192e936d408b9db22d639461519e0f4858b1937f679e139632199f5a
spent
true